Detection of the Force Distribution Close to the Effective Site in Forming Machines for a Force Control
Ever higher demands are placed on the quality and complexity of formed sheet metal parts, whereby the efficiency of the processes may not be affected. Thus it becomes more difficult to ensure process stability. In order to reduce rejected parts it is necessary to improve forming technologies and processes. Closed loop control of process variables with an influence to the quality of a part is a promising approach. Therefor the reliable metrological acquisition of such a parameter is a basic requirement. Forming force respectively force distribution has an influence on component quality and seems to be a suited value. In this paper, a measurement setup and its implementation in a demonstrator is described. First metrological examinations show occurring effects during eccentric load cases and the derivation of spindle forces via additional load paths in the machine frame. This knowledge will be used for the development of a force control.
